Output 12034d3afee906110b418e3b530a47fad6c85bb0dd3c57244e77ec3f06dd9e90:1

value
1506681
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b0be66dae49b039632c4286ef5e3a960344d18e OP_EQUALVERIFY OP_CHECKSIG
address
1KWcRmzkrDpC1iRaX1Lf39Yn81bgCRuhby
transaction
12034d3afee906110b418e3b530a47fad6c85bb0dd3c57244e77ec3f06dd9e90
spent
true